Cyber Essentials is a UK government-backed cyber security certification scheme designed to help organisations protect themselves from common online threats.

It focuses on essential cyber security practices to safeguard against a range of cyber attacks.  Here’s a summary of the key aspects of the accreditation’s:

  1. Basic Cyber security Controls: Implementing fundamental cyber security controls enhance an organisation’s overall security posture, and these are designed to protect against common cyber threats.
  2. Two Certification Levels: There are two levels of certification. The basic certification involves self-assessment, whilst the Plus requires an independent assessment by a certified cyber security professional.
  3. Five Key Control Areas:
    a. Secure Configuration: Ensuring that systems and software are securely configured.
    b. Boundary Firewalls and Internet Gateways: Implementing measures to protect network boundaries.
    c. Access Control: Managing user access and permissions to systems and data.
    d. Malware Protection: Implementing effective anti-malware measures.
    e. Patch Management: Keeping software and devices up to date with security patches.
  4. Protection from Common Threats: Helps organisations defend against prevalent cyber threats like malware, phishing, and other online attacks.
  5. Risk Reduction: By implementing these controls, organisations can reduce their vulnerability to cyber attacks and protect sensitive information.
  6. Compliance with Government Contracts: Some UK government contracts, and certain organisations require suppliers and partners to hold a Cyber Essentials certification.
  7. Demonstrated Commitment to Cyber security: Achieving Cyber Essentials certification demonstrates an organisation’s commitment to cyber security best practices, which can inspire trust among customers, partners, and stakeholders.
  8. Continuous Improvement: Maintaining a Cyber Essentials certification encourages organisations to continuously improve their cyber security practices.

These accreditation’s provide a structured approach to basic cyber security measures, helping organisations mitigate common cyber threats and enhance their overall security resilience.
